Richard,

The crank for your VV-XII is part number 3194BGP and is peculiar to only
the XII  (GP=Gold Plated) according to the VIctor Repair Parts listing. 

The dimensions are described as follows:

Length Bend to Bend 3-9/16"  
Length  Bend to End   2-1/8"
1/4" Inside thread

Unfortunately it is not clear if these are dimensions from the center or
inside of the bends, maybe someone with a  crank can verify these
dimensions.
